This triangulation station is part of the National Geodetic Survey's network, which establishes and maintains the official geodetic control framework for the United States. Located in Park County, Wyoming, at coordinates 44.67761° N, 110.48580° W, this trig point serves as a fundamental reference for surveying, mapping, and geospatial projects across the region. The ellipsoidal elevation of 2333.8 meters reflects its position in the mountainous terrain characteristic of northwestern Wyoming. Triangulation stations like this provide accurate, monumented positions essential for cadastral surveys, engineering projects, and geographic information systems. Verification and documentation of such benchmark locations ensure the integrity and reliability of surveying work dependent upon established control networks. NGS maintains these points to support the nation's surveying infrastructure and geospatial data accuracy standards.
